Israeli troops bombed the Al Ahli Arab Hospital in Gaza city, one of the two remaining centres in the Gaza governorate, official Pelestinian news agency Wafa has reported, quoting local sources. The top floor of the hospital, housing the radiology department, was seen damaged in images circulated by local news outlets. This comes two days after the Kamal Adwan Hospital in Gaza’s north went out of service, following an Israeli siege, bombing and burning of the centre and emptying it out of patients and staff members and detaining the hospital’s director among 240 others including dozens of wounded and other patients.
